Output 998500c11e426ac211304d843e09b4e5036647b9729b48071d78f4db311249ad:0

value
677309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66315fff99e584f8c92b02e2364d316084ba5d1 OP_EQUAL
address
3MEbECxqWHpLek151PPBFUJXUjUX9sCURP
transaction
998500c11e426ac211304d843e09b4e5036647b9729b48071d78f4db311249ad
spent
true